web-dev-qa-db-ja.com

UbuntuはWindows共有をマウントできません

Windows共有を終了してアクセスしたいので、Ubuntu14.04システムで次のコマンドを実行しました。

Sudo mount.cifs -o username=dana //192.168.1.4/Users  /mnt/

Sudoパスワードとwindwosユーザーパスワードを入力した後、これらのエラーが発生しました

マウントエラー(13):アクセスが拒否されましたmount.cifs(8)のマニュアルページを参照してください(例:man mount.cifs)

2
Dan

アカウントにマウントする権限があることを確認してください。 smbclientを使用してドライブにアクセスしてみてください。smbclientコマンドを使用すると、マウントできない理由として、はるかに意味のあるエラーメッセージが表示されます。

例えば:

smbclient \\machinename\foldername -U [username] [password]

それが機能する場合は、次のようなsmbプロンプトが表示されます。

smb>

そうでない場合は、NT_LOGON_FAILUIRE(パスワードが間違っている)などのエラーが発生するか、ログインは機能するがそのフォルダーにアクセスできない場合は、そのエラーが発生します(頭のてっぺんから思い出せません) )

Smbclientおよびsmbclientの構文については、こちらを確認してください。
Samba/CIFS/SMBFSを使用してLinuxにWindows共有をマウントする

1
ben

まず、ユーザーが共有へのアクセス権を持っているかどうかを常に確認します。フォルダへのアクセス許可だけでなく、ドメインオプションを使用し、-vを使用してデバッグメッセージを確認します。

0
synchris

mount(8)-Linuxのマニュアルページ

Return Codes
mount has the following return codes (the bits can be ORed):
0: success
1: incorrect invocation or permissions
2: system error (out of memory, cannot fork, no more loop devices)
4: internal mount bug
8: user interrupt
16: problems writing or locking /etc/mtab
32: mount failure
64: some mount succeeded

これは、3つのエラーが発生したことを示しています。

  1. ユーザー割り込み
  2. 内部マウントバグ
  3. 誤った呼び出しまたは権限
0
LDC3

これを使用して、Windows共有をローカルのLinuxマシンにマウントします。

Sudo apt-get install cifs-utils
Sudo mount -t cifs //hostname.your.windows.machine.hostname/Your_Share /home/user/shares/hostname/ -o vers=3.0,username=user,domain=hostname,uid=1000

それが助けになることを願っています。

0